Red flag #1: too good to be true. many romance scammers offer up good looking photos and tales of financial success to trick people into falling in love before asking their victims to send money. if they seem “too perfect,” your alarm bells should ring. red flag #2: in a hurry to get off the dating site or app. In 2022, the median individual amount loss to a romance scam was reportedly $4,400. (ftc, february 2023) the reported financial losses due to romance scams increased by more than 80% from 2021’s high of $2,400 to $4,400 in 2022. (ftc, february 2023) confidence romance scams cost individuals over $730 million in 2022.
